    Presented is an algorithm which in a finite (but exponential) number of steps computes all solutions of an absolute value equation Ax + B|x| = b (A, B square), or fails. Failure has never been observed for randomly generated data. The algorithm can also be used for computation of all solutions of a linear complementarity problem.
